What Are UV DTF Stickers?

UV DTF (Ultraviolet Direct-to-Film) is an innovative process combining UV printing and cold transfer technologies. Unlike traditional UV printing that sprays ink directly onto the surface of an object, UV DTF prints UV ink (including color ink, white ink, and varnish) first onto a special release film (A film). It is then covered with a transfer film (B film) to create a ready-to-apply sticker.

These stickers usually feature a distinct 3D embossed tactile feel and a high-gloss finish, often referred to as “crystal labels” in some markets.

Core Advantages of UV DTF Stickers

Why have UV DTF stickers taken the customization and packaging market by storm so quickly? It mainly comes down to these key advantages:

  • No Weeding Required: Traditional vinyl or die-cut stickers require a lot of manual labor to weed out the negative space. UV DTF stickers are ready to peel and apply, greatly improving production and packaging efficiency.
  • Wide Range of Applications: It breaks through the shape and height limitations of traditional flatbed UV printers. It adheres perfectly to almost any hard, smooth, or slightly curved surface, including glass, metal, ceramics, acrylic, plastic, and wood.
  • Exceptional Durability: Once cured, UV ink is highly resistant to scratches, water, and UV rays. Even in outdoor environments or after multiple washes, the colors remain vibrant and fade-resistant.
  • Premium Visual and Tactile Experience: By layering the ink (white base + color ink + varnish finish), the stickers naturally have a 3D embossed effect. This significantly elevates the texture of product packaging, making it perfect for high-end cosmetics packaging, crafts, and brand merchandise.

UV DTF vs. Traditional DTF (Apparel Transfer)

For beginners, it’s easy to confuse UV DTF with standard DTF. Here is the main difference:

  • Standard DTF (Direct-to-Film): Primarily used for soft fabrics (like t-shirts and canvas bags). It requires applying hot melt powder and using a heat press for high-temperature transfer.
  • UV DTF: Designed specifically for hard surfaces. No hot melt powder or heat press is needed. It’s a “cold transfer” process—you simply apply it with physical pressure and peel off the film.

How to Apply UV DTF Stickers (4 Simple Steps)

Proper application maximizes the sticker’s adhesion and lifespan.

  1. Clean the Surface: Use alcohol or a cleaner to wipe away dust, oil, and moisture from the target surface. Ensure it is completely dry.
  2. Peel the Backing: Peel off the transparent backing film (A film) from the UV DTF sticker, leaving the design on the sticky transfer film (B film).
  3. Position and Apply: Align the design on the target area and gently apply it. Press down firmly from the center outwards, or use a squeegee to smooth it out and eliminate air bubbles, ensuring the design fully adheres to the surface.
  4. Peel the Transfer Film: Once firmly attached, slowly peel off the top transparent transfer film (B film). Your stunning 3D design is now perfectly transferred to the object.

1. Do UV DTF stickers require a heat press?

No. UV DTF is a cold transfer technology. It comes with a strong, eco-friendly adhesive and only requires physical pressure (pressing by hand or using a squeegee) to complete the transfer. No heating equipment is needed.

2. Can UV DTF stickers be applied to clothes?

No. UV DTF stickers are designed for hard surfaces (such as glass, plastic, metal, wood, etc.) and lack the stretchability and washability required for fabrics. If you need custom apparel, please choose traditional DTF heat transfer technology.

3. Are UV DTF stickers waterproof and scratch-resistant?

Yes, they are highly durable. Thanks to the UV-cured ink and varnish coating, they are not only waterproof and sun-proof but also resistant to daily wear and scratches. They are perfect for tumblers, car decals, and outdoor product branding.

4. Can I wash the item immediately after applying the sticker?

It is recommended to let it sit for 24 to 48 hours before washing or putting it in a dishwasher. This allows the adhesive to fully cure and bond with the surface for maximum adhesion.

5. If I place it crooked, can I peel it off and reapply it?

Generally, no. UV DTF stickers have extremely strong adhesion. Once firmly pressed down, forcibly peeling them off may tear the design or leave adhesive residue on the surface. We highly recommend careful positioning before applying.
